Kim Kardashian has become a household name, evolving from a reality TV personality to a global fashion icon and successful entrepreneur. Her journey in the public eye began in 2007, marking the start of a career that would redefine celebrity influence and brand-building in the digital age.

Kardashian’s initial foray into the fashion world was as a celebrity stylist and closet organizer. This early experience in the industry laid the groundwork for her future endeavors in fashion and retail. In 2007, she and her sisters opened DASH boutiques, their first venture into the retail space. This same year saw the launch of the reality TV series “Keeping Up with the Kardashians,” which would catapult Kim and her family to unprecedented levels of fame.

The reality show became a cultural phenomenon, offering viewers an intimate look into the lives of the Kardashian-Jenner clan. Kim’s personal style and fashion choices became topics of widespread discussion and emulation. Her influence in the fashion world grew steadily, culminating in her first attendance at the prestigious Met Gala in 2013. This event marked her official entry into the upper echelons of the fashion world.

Kim Kardashian’s style evolution was significantly influenced by her ex-husband, Ye West (formerly known as Kanye West). The rapper, known for his own fashion ventures, played a crucial role in elevating Kim’s fashion status. Their collaboration in style helped transform Kim from a reality TV star into a bonafide fashion icon, sought after by high-end designers and brands.

In 2017, Kardashian made a pivotal move that would cement her status as a business mogul. She co-founded KKW Beauty, leveraging her massive social media following and personal brand to launch a successful cosmetics line. The success of KKW Beauty caught the attention of beauty giant Coty, which later acquired a stake in the company, further validating Kim’s business acumen.

However, it was the launch of SKIMS in 2019, co-founded with Jens Grede, that truly showcased Kim Kardashian’s ability to identify and fill a gap in the market. SKIMS, a shapewear and loungewear brand, has been revolutionary in its approach to size inclusivity and diversity. The brand offers a wide range of sizes and skin tones, addressing a long-standing issue in the underwear and shapewear industry.

SKIMS’ success has been nothing short of phenomenal. The brand quickly expanded beyond shapewear to include loungewear and swimwear, and even collaborated with luxury fashion house Fendi, owned by LVMH. This collaboration bridged the gap between affordable, inclusive shapewear and high-end fashion, further elevating the SKIMS brand.

The rapid growth and popularity of SKIMS led to a valuation of over $3.2 billion, a testament to Kim Kardashian’s business savvy and her ability to translate her personal brand into a successful commercial venture. The brand’s success is not just in its financial valuation but also in its cultural impact. SKIMS has been credited with bringing size diversity and a range of skin tones into the mainstream of shapewear and underwear, challenging industry norms and promoting inclusivity.

Kim Kardashian’s influence in the fashion world extends beyond her own brands. In 2021, she signed a partnership to supply underwear, loungewear, and pajamas to the US Olympic team, a move that further solidified SKIMS’ position as a major player in the apparel industry. This partnership highlighted the brand’s versatility and appeal, from everyday consumers to elite athletes.

The same year, Kardashian was awarded the Wall Street Journal Brand Innovator award, recognizing her contributions to the fashion and business worlds. This accolade underscored her transformation from a reality TV star to a respected entrepreneur and innovator in the fashion industry.

Kim’s fashion influence continues to grow and evolve. She has become a face of luxury fashion house Balenciaga, fronting a campaign in February 2022. Her appearance at the 2021 Met Gala in a conversation-provoking full-coverage Balenciaga outfit further cemented her status as a fashion risk-taker and trendsetter.
